Output e2640057b09a4ef049b8daad5e18f27ab11762bf6aac2f19b719842622040826:0

value
10623330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f6500f2dd5680f05473b3a7dfa9f868d02fc25 OP_EQUAL
address
3M74FKYAa4vfjqGL9c9u1fKTHS8PfL9MPJ
transaction
e2640057b09a4ef049b8daad5e18f27ab11762bf6aac2f19b719842622040826
spent
true